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Warrington Central to Woolwich Dockyard start from as little as £43.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Warrington Central to Woolwich Dockyard start from £79.80 one way, or £114.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Warrington Central to Woolwich Dockyard are available for £201.60 one way, or £403.20 return

Facilities and Amenities

Warrington Central is a well-equipped station with a range of facilities designed to make every passenger's journey as smooth as possible. The ticket office is open from 06:00 to 20:40 on weekdays and slightly later on Sundays, ensuring you have ample time to get your tickets. The ticket machines are accessible, and you'll find induction loops installed for enhanced communication aids. In addition, smartcards can be issued and validated here, making it simple to hop on and off the train seamlessly.

The station offers step-free access throughout, categorizing it as a Category A station. While there's a lack of tactile pavings, lifts are available to aid movement between platforms. For day-to-day conveniences, you'll find refreshment facilities and shops, although the absence of an ATM might prompt you to prepare beforehand. The goods news for cyclists: there's bicycle storage available on-site with 24 sheltered spaces right at platforms 1 and 2.

Essential Facilities and Amenities

Woolwich Dockyard station provides several key amenities to ensure a smooth travel experience. The ticket office operates only during weekday mornings, opening from 06:40 to 13:25, yet fear not if you travel outside these hours. The station is equipped with accessible ticket machines located by the entrance to platform 1, offering travelers the flexibility to purchase or collect pre-purchased tickets at their convenience.

For those needing additional assistance, the station includes an accessible ticket machine and induction loop, enhancing the experience for travelers with disabilities. Offering a reasonable degree of step-free access, particularly towards services traveling away from London, the station is marked as a Category B3 for accessibility. Nonetheless, important to note, platform 1, used for services toward London, remains inaccessible without stairs, which could be a consideration for some travelers.
